Industry Today: New Data Asks: Could Generation Z Save Manufacturing?

Daan Assen


L2L survey suggests that Generation Z may be the answer to employment problems being faced by manufacturing.

 

'The 2019 L2L Manufacturing Index, an annual measurement of the American public’s perceptions of U.S. manufacturing, found that adults in Generation Z (those aged 18-22) are 19% more likely to have had a counselor, teacher or mentor suggest they look into manufacturing as a viable career option when compared to the general population. One-third (32%) of Generation Z has had manufacturing suggested to them as a career option, as compared to only 18% of Millennials and 13% of the general population.
